Comprehending Mesothelioma and Its Causes
Mesothelioma is a malignant tumor that establishes in the mesothelium, the protective lining covering the lungs, abdominal area, and heart. The primary cause of mesothelioma is direct exposure to as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ral as soon as widely utilized in building and construction, insulation, and many commercial applications. Other prospective causes include genetic aspects and exposure to radiation or other carcinogenic products; nevertheless, asbestos direct exposure stays the most common.

For those identified with mesothelioma, seeking legal aid is important for several reasons:

Understanding Rights: Individuals affected by mesothelioma have specific rights, including the right to submit a lawsuit versus accountable parties.

Settlement: Legal action can cause monetary payment that helps cover medical bills, lost incomes, and emotional distress.

Specialist Guidance: Mesothelioma cases can be complex, and customized legal help makes sure that victims browse the legal procedure efficiently.

Time-sensitive Claims: Legal declares need to typically be submitted within a particular timeframe (statute of constraints), making timely legal recommendations important.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)What is the timeline for a mesothelioma lawsuit?
The timeline can differ widely depending upon the intricacy of the case and the jurisdiction in which the case is filed. Cases can take months or years to resolve, however lots of settled cases might finish within a year.
How much compensation can a mesothelioma victim anticipate?
Compensation quantities differ significantly based on aspects like the severity of the disease, the company responsible for asbestos direct exposure, and the jurisdiction. Settlements can range from thousands to countless dollars.
Can I submit a claim if I was exposed to asbestos indirectly?
Yes, people who were indirectly exposed, such as member of the family of workers who brought home asbestos fibers, might have legal recourse.
What if the business responsible is no longer in business?
If the accountable company has actually stated personal bankruptcy, victims might have the alternative of submitting claims with asbestos trust funds developed to compensate victims.
Do I need to go to court for a mesothelioma lawsuit?
Not all cases need a trial. Many mesothelioma cases are settled out of court, however some might continue to trial if a fair settlement can not be reached.
